Output 17a8744eadeeb858e29315e1312a39c2b79c86a23819f09ebad95f8b34381e3e:4

value
25017136
script pubkey
OP_0 OP_PUSHBYTES_20 2fb291ae126f707d8060fed7b8868133b55b8dd5
address
bc1q97efrtsjdac8mqrqlmtm3p5pxw64hrw4f2lvq7
transaction
17a8744eadeeb858e29315e1312a39c2b79c86a23819f09ebad95f8b34381e3e
spent
true